Accepted - No Charge

Walter’s welcomes the following items at our Recycling Center: Residents, there is no charge to you for recycled items.

*Commercial customers, are subject to a fee.

  • Aluminum & metal cans: empty and rinse
  • Cardboard: flatten*
  • Glass jars & bottles: empty & rinse
  • Plastics #1,2, & 5 – Plastic bottles & jugs w/necks: empty & rinse
  • Magazines ~ Mixed Paper ~ Newspaper ~ Phone Books*
  • Batteries: Alkaline, lithium, Ni-cad and button batteries.
  • Eyeglasses
  • Ink Cartridges
  • Cell Phones
  • Scrap Metal  (no redemption is paid on scrap metal).
  • Bicycles (All Bicycles are collected year-round and then donated to a program called Bikes4kids).
  • Textiles | USAgain will accept clothes, shoes, accessories, and household textiles in reusable condition: Look for the USAgain box at our facility and place items of reusable condition in the box. Looking for more information? Click the link https://usagain.com/items-we-accept

Accepted - With Fee

Walters Recycling and Refuse also accepts the following items at our Recycling Center, fees do apply.

 

 More than one yard of Cardboard is subject to a fee *commercial customers

  • Bulky Furniture
  • Mattresses
  • Appliances (water softeners must be emptied)
  • E-Waste
  • Extra bags of Refuse
  • Outdoor items ~ (examples: Basketball hoop, outdoor pool, gas or charcoal grill, lawnmower, snow blower, outdoor trinkets etc.).  Snow blowers, lawn mowers and other outdoor equipment must be drained of all fluids (gas & oil) prior to drop off.
  • Construction Demo
